Nahaufnahme von zwei weiblichen Entwicklern, die zusammenarbeiten, während sie remote arbeiten. Eine Entwicklerin hat ihren Surface-Laptop mit Aufklebern personalisiert.

Cloud Native

Alles, was du über die Entwicklung skalierbarer Cloud-Anwendungen wissen solltest.

Entwickle Cloud Native-Anwendungen mit Microsoft Azure

Cloud Native ist momentan einer der wichtigsten Ansätze in der Software-Entwicklung – dahinter versteckt sich eine spezielle Herangehensweise, wie du deine Anwendungen erstellst und betreibst.

Kurz zusammengefasst sind Cloud Native-Anwendungen verteilte und skalierbare Systeme, die für die Cloud entwickelt werden, sodass sie Cloud-Vorteile wie Skalierbarkeit, Flexibilität, Ausfallsicherheit und Elastizität bestmöglich nutzen können. Basis dafür sind sowohl Container-, Serverless- und Microservices-Technologien als auch agile Methoden und DevOps-Ansätze.

Vorteile von Cloud Native

Im Gegensatz zur gängigen Entwicklung von Unternehmensanwendungen, die meist On-Premises ausgeführt werden, benötigst du für Cloud Native-Anwendungen eine andere Architektur. Doch der Ansatz lohnt sich, du profitierst von folgenden Vorteilen:

Flexible Wahl

der Programmiersprache und Verwendung unterschiedlicher Sprachen

Schnellere Releases

dank des modularen Aufbaus und des Einsatzes von Containern und Microservices

Höhere Kundenzufriedenheit

und bessere Customer Experience durch regelmäßige Verbesserungen und neue Features

Zeitersparnis

durch Automatisierung

Skalierbarkeit

je nach Bedarf und Auslastung deiner Anwendung

Ausfallsicherheit

durch Redundanz in der Cloud

Tools und Technologien

Um Cloud Native-Anwendungen zu erstellen und zu betreiben, steht dir eine große Auswahl an Tools und Technologien zur Verfügung – diese reichen von Azure Arc über Azure Kubernetes Service bis Azure Functions.

Azure Container Apps

Azure Container Apps ist ein verwalteter Cloud-Dienst, der dir einen serverlosen, anwendungszentrierten Hosting-Service bietet, bei dem du keine zugrunde liegenden VMs, Orchestratoren oder andere Cloud-Infrastrukturen verwalten musst.

Azure Kubernetes Service

Mit Azure Kubernetes Service (AKS) können Kubernetes Cluster auf Microsoft Azure bereitgestellt werden. Der Azure Service übernimmt die Verantwortung für verschiedene Aufgaben rund um den Betrieb der Kubernetes-Umgebung.

Azure Container Instances

Azure Container Instances ist eine Lösung für alle Szenarien, die in isolierten Containern ohne Orchestrierung betrieben werden sollen. Die Lösung ermöglicht ein bedarfsgesteuertes Ausführen von Docker-Containern in einer verwalteten, serverlosen Azure-Umgebung.

Azure Container Registry

Mit Azure Container Registry kannst du Container-Images und -Artefakte in einer privaten Registrierung für alle Arten von Container-Bereitstellungen erstellen, speichern und verwalten.

Azure DevOps

Azure DevOps bietet verschiedene Dienste, die Entwicklungsteams bei der Planung von Projekten, der Zusammenarbeit, der Entwicklung, der Bereitstellung und dem Betrieb von Anwendungen unterstützen.

Azure Service Fabric

Azure Service Fabric ist eine Plattform für verteilte Systeme, die das Packen, Bereitstellen und Verwalten skalierbarer und zuverlässiger Microservices und Container vereinfacht.

Azure Functions

Azure Functions ist ein serverloser Compute-Dienst, mit dem ereignisgesteuerter Code ausgeführt werden kann, ohne eine explizite Infrastruktur bereitstellen oder verwalten zu müssen.

Distributed Application Runtime

Distributed Application Runtime (Dapr) ist eine portable, ereignisgesteuerte Laufzeitumgebung, auf deren Basis Entwickler Microservice-Anwendungen erstellen können.

Open Application Model

Das Open Application Model (OAM) ist eine Spezifikation für die Erstellung Cloud-Native-Anwendungen von Microsoft und Alibaba. Es handelt sich um eine Art Vorlage für die Beschreibung von Apps, dadurch kann die Definition der Anwendung sauber von den operativen Details getrennt werden.

Azure Arc

Mit den Technologien in Azure Arc werden die Azure-Services und -Management-Tools auch für Unternehmen verfügbar gemacht, die andere Cloud-Umgebungen oder Infrastrukturen verwenden.

Nutze die Ressourcen auf dieser Seite, um dich im Detail zum Thema Cloud Native-Entwicklung zu informieren.

Azure Developer Community Hub

Azure für Developer - gehe auf unser GitHub Repository und klick dich unsere umfangreiche Azure-Ressourcensammlung. Hier findest du alles, was das Entwicklerherz begehrt, auch zum Thema Cloud Native.

Eine Frau sitzt auf einer Coch mit einem Tablet auf dem Schoß.

News

Aktuelles zum Thema Cloud Native

Zur News Übersicht

CodingAzureCloud Native

Die wichtigsten News der Kalenderwoche 28/2024: Microsoft Azure, Security und mehr

12. Jul 2024 - Was hat sich in der vergangenen Woche rund um die Microsoft-Plattform getan? Gab es wichtige Ankündigungen oder neue Wissensressourcen? Unser TechWiese-Team hat interessante Links für dich zusammengestellt.

AzureBetriebssystemeCloud Native

Jetzt herunterladen: So migriest du deine VMware-Workloads auf Azure

11. Jul 2024 - Hole dir die wichtigsten Informationen rund um die Migration von VMware-Lösungen in die Microsoft-Cloud – ganz kompakt in diesem Whitepaper.

CodingAzureCloud Native

Die wichtigsten News der Kalenderwoche 27/2024: Visual Studio Code, Microsoft Azure und mehr

5. Jul 2024

.NETAzureCloud Native

Save the Date: .NET Aspire Developers Day am 23. Juli 2024

1. Jul 2024

.NETApp & Data ModernizationArtificial Intelligence

Die wichtigsten News der Kalenderwoche 26/2024: Azure, GitHub und mehr

28. Jun 2024

AzureCloud Native

Neue Funktionen bei Azure Arc: Bessere Integration von Multi-Cloud-Umgebungen

26. Jun 2024

Eine Frau sitzt an ihrem Arbeitsplatz und und spricht mit einer Kollegin.

Events

Kommende Events zum Thema Cloud Native

Zum Event-Katalog

18. Juli

Microsoft Azure Virtual Training Day: Fundamentals

​​In diesem zweitägigen Training erhalten Sie einen Überblick der wichtigsten Grundlagen und Funktionalitäten von Microsoft Azure. Zudem dient es als Vorbereitung auf die branchenweit anerkannte Zertifizierungsprüfung für die AZ-900 Microsoft Azure Fundamentals.

23. Juli

Microsoft Power Platform - Fabric Analyst in a Day

Dieses Training ist für fortgeschrittene Power BI-Data Analysts mit Erfahrung in Power BI, aber neu in Microsoft Fabric. Es wird gezeigt, wie Sie Ihre Daten in einer einzigen Quelle der Wahrheit konsolidieren, und mit dieser Ihre Daten analysieren und aussagekräftige Erkenntnisse gewinnen können. Sie durchlaufen die End-to-End- Analyselösung von der Datenaufnahme bis zur Erstellung von Berichten mit automatischer Aktualisierung.

23. Juli

Azure Architects Connect - Windows in der Cloud - Azure Virtual Desktop & Windows 365

24. Juli

Microsoft Azure Virtual Training Day: Generative AI Fundamentals

31. Juli

Microsoft Power Platform - Fabric Analyst in a Day

1. August

Microsoft Azure Virtual Training Day: Migrate and Modernize SAP on the Microsoft Cloud

Bau dein Cloud Native-Wissen aus – passende Ressourcen für jedes Skill-Level

Ganz egal, ob du gerade deine ersten Schritte mit den Cloud Native-Technologien machst, schon erste Grundkenntnisse besitzt oder bereits über Profiwissen verfügst – mit unseren E-Books, Tutorials und vielen weiteren Inhalten kannst du dein Wissen weiter ausbauen!

Alle LevelWebseite

Microsoft Reactor

Du willst den nächsten Karriereschritt als Developer oder arbeitest an der nächsten großen Idee? Microsoft Reactor bringt dich mit anderen Developern und Start-ups zusammen, die die gleichen Ziele haben wie du.

ProfiTraining

Azure Adventure Day

Bei diesem kostenfreien und interaktiven Lernformat eignest du dir auf spielerische Weise neues Wissen rund um die Entwicklung, Bereitstellung und den Betrieb von Anwendungen mit Azure und Kubernetes an.

Alle LevelOnline-Kurs

Cloud Skills Challenge

Zeig, was du kannst: Jeden Monat warten neue Herausforderungen auf dich. Löse die Aufgaben, beweise dein Wissen und führe das Leaderboard an.

FortgeschrittenOnline-Kurs

Erstellen von nativen Cloud-Apps mit Azure und Open-Source-Software

Dieser praxisorientierte Lernpfad demonstriert die wesentlichen Aspekte der Auswahl von Komponenten für native Cloud-Apps, das Erstellen von Integrationen und die Bereitstellung auf Azure.

FortgeschrittenWhitepaper

Auswahl der richtigen Azure-Dienste für Ihre Anwendungen – kein Entweder-oder

Lerne, wie du den richtigen Azure-Dienst für deine Anwendung auswählst. Zum Beispiel: Soll ich meine Anwendung in in Azure Kubernetes Service oder Azure App Service hosten?

FortgeschrittenWhitepaper

Azure für Hybrid-, Multi-Cloud- und Edge-Umgebungen

Lerne in diesem Whitepaper, wie du eine Hybrid-Cloud-Infrastruktur für deine Organisation implementierst und Kubernetes-Apps im großen Stil verwaltest.

ProfiWhitepaper

APIs + Microservices

Finde heraus, wie du eine API-Plattform für Unternehmen erstellst. Der praktische Leitfaden enthält alle wichtigen Infos rund um APIs und Microservices.

ProfiWhitepaper

Mapbook zur cloudnativen Azure-Architektur

Eine Anleitung für die Erstellung von Cloud-Architekturen, lade dir das kostenfreie Mapbook zur cloudnativen Azure-Architektur herunter.

“Cloud-Native-Technologien ermöglichen es Unternehmen, skalierbare Anwendungen in modernen, dynamischen Umgebungen wie Public, Private und Hybrid Cloud-Umgebungen zu erstellen und auszuführen.”

Definition Cloud Native von der Cloud Native Computing Foundation

Weiterführende Ressourcen zum Thema Cloud Native

Noch mehr Cloud Native gibt es auf diesen Seiten – klick dich durch jede Menge Blogbeiträge, lass dich von den Erfahrungen renommierter Unternehmen inspirieren und hol‘ dir auf Produkt- und Technologieseiten tiefergehende Informationen.

Microsoft Developer folgen
  • Facebook
  • Twitter
Microsoft IT Pro folgen
  • Facebook
Zurück nach oben